Q. Are there any foods in which Vitamin B is naturally found?
Answer
There are a wide variety of food sources in which Vitamin B complex is found. If one incorporates them into the diet the deficiency will not occur. The food sources are as follows:MilkCheeseEggsRed meat and chickenSalmon and tuna fishWhole grains and cerealsVegetables like beetroot potatoes spinach kale and avocadoKidney beans black beans and chickpeasNuts and seedsSoy milkCitrus fruits banana and watermelon
